A SUMMARY OF HOUSE BILL 6490 AS INTRODUCED 11-7-02
House Bill 6490 would amend the Revised Judicature Act of 1961 to raise the "remonumentation fee" that must be paid when recording instruments with a county register of deeds from $2 to $4. Under the act, certain individuals, entities, and agencies are exempt from paying the fee, in specific circumstances. The bill would create a further exemption for foreclosing governmental units recording a judgment or a notice of judgment under section 78k of the General Property Tax Act. (Section 78k sets forth procedures for a county or the state, acting on the county's behalf, to follow when foreclosing tax delinquent property.)
The RJA directs the state treasurer to deposit the remonumentation fee to the Survey and Remonumentation Fund. Money from the fund is used to finance the implementation of counties' monumentation and remonumentation plans required by the State Survey and Remonumentation Act (Public Act 345 of 1990).
(MCL 600.2567a)
